What happens
Frankenstein's Daughter is an independently made 1958 American black-and-white science fiction/horror film drama, produced by Marc Frederic and George Fowley, directed by Richard E. Cunha, that stars John Ashley, Sandra Knight, Donald Murphy, and Sally Todd. The film was distributed by Astor Pictures and was released theatrically on December 15, 1958 as a double feature with Missile to the Moon (1958). The film, set in 1950s America, tells the story of the creation of the first female "Frankenstein's monster". The film bears little resemblance to the Frankenstein novel by Mary Shelley.
